Titan Operating System S.L. is looking for a Senior Full Stack Developer to help build platforms and tools for partner onboarding. The role involves full-stack development, API integration, architectural ownership, and technical leadership.
Requirements
- 5+ years of experience building full-stack web applications with Node.js and TypeScript
- Deep expertise in React.js and extensive hands-on experience with Next.js in a production environment
- Proven experience building and consuming APIs
- Solid experience with relational databases (like PostgreSQL) and ORMs (specifically Prisma)
- Hands-on experience managing CI/CD pipelines (GitHub Actions preferred) and working with Docker
- Strong understanding of computer science fundamentals, software architecture, and best practices
- A passion for writing clean, high-quality, and maintainable code
- Strong experience with modern testing frameworks like Vitest and React Testing Library (RTL)
Benefits
- Centrally located office in the heart of Barcelona, with public transportation nearby
- Competitive compensation
- Private health insurance
- Friendly, diverse, and international work environment
- Opportunity to work outside of your comfort zone and develop professionally in an exciting and fast-growing CTV industry